Eager to be a pro in Angular UI and create visually alluring web apps that astonish the audience? Hold tight because we are taking an exciting flight intoi the tucked-away spaces of the angular ui. Let's move in for a few tips and tricks that would help your web apps glow in brilliance.
Top Picks and Tricks for Angular UI.
1. Learn Angular Material
Built-In Components: Spoon-feed your sleek and responsive design just a taste using the vast collection of pre-built Angular Material components.
Custom Themes: Modify the default themes to meet your brand's styles. Experiment with colors, typography, and layout styles and make one stand out from others.
2. Use Reactive Forms
Dynamic Form Controls: Build dynamic ones and set complex form controls, with reactive forms wherein the form controls would react to changes made by the user in real-time.
Validation at Your Fingertips: Let powerful validation logic guard data integrity and enhance user experience.
3. Performance Optimization
Lazy Loading: Optimize the first load and, hence, the performance with lazy loading, so that you load modules only when they are needed.
Ahead-of-Time (AOT): Compile your application during the build so your application is rendered faster with AOT compilation for improved performance.
4. Communication among Components
Communication: Get the hang of command input and output decorators for perfect communication of a parent and child component.
Services as Communicators: Use services to share data and logic among components that have made your application more modular and maintainable.
5. Use Angular CLI
To Generate Components and Services: Use Angular CLI and smoothly generate components, services, and other important parts of your application. Time-saver and consistent.
In-Built Testing: Use the built-in testing feature of Angular CLI and write/run unit tests without hassle.